Transaction 3aeac76046ae807817c7ee0bbd735b0956becc702394274f25081ec11f4d23df

3 Input
2 Outputs
  • 3aeac76046ae807817c7ee0bbd735b0956becc702394274f25081ec11f4d23df:0
  • value  947897
    address  3HsfZLstjvCMEf1PAh7BBfSGSbXFSMrstj
  • 3aeac76046ae807817c7ee0bbd735b0956becc702394274f25081ec11f4d23df:1
  • value  23203383
    address  3Pcf2CwiPN3bMnykMfJpGMsMANxaRcWjy3